The senate of Chile approved the agreement on a zone to free trade with Brazil

Show original
The draft agreement on free trade between Chile and Brazil was approved by the upper house of the National Congress of Chile on August 12, reports Prensa Latina. It is noted that this document supplements the Agreement on the economic cooperation, concluded by Chile with the countries Mercosur in 1990. In it questions of trade and economic cooperation, removal of technical barriers in trade, questions of government purchases, the competition, the practician of permission of arising disputes, simplification of an order of providing business visas and so forth are considered.
